Subject: Pricing call on the Lunavale line

Finance folks — we're moving the Lunavale skincare line up roughly eight percent at the spring reset, with the travel sizes held flat as an entry point. Margins finally make sense under this structure. Model it through by Thursday, please. Here's the confidential context on where we're headed.

confidential, yahip-hagug: Gorixax Logistics plans to lower the Ulaael list price by 26.6 percent in October. The pricing group signed off on a budget of $199.9 million for Project Holix. The renewal with Kasdorox Systems closes at $137.5 million a year, 8.2 percent above the last contract. Project Lamion slips by a full year because of the audit delay.

**Alert: ProctorQueue backlog high (VigilEdge)**

This fires when the exam-proctoring review queue on VigilEdge sits above 500 pending sessions for 10+ minutes. Usually it's a stuck worker after a deploy — bounce the review workers and watch it drain. If it doesn't clear in 20 minutes, students start seeing delayed exam starts, which gets noisy fast. Check the Dunmore dashboard first. Still stuck? Escalate to the proctoring platform team.

escalation mailbox, yajeg-bageg: quenax.olidor@lumiccorp.internal

Runbook: Deploybeak chat bot. The bot answers deploy-status queries in the support channel. If it stops responding, check the poller first; it reads release events every 20 s and goes silent if the queue backs up. Restart order: poller, then responder, never both at once. Stale answers usually mean the events table is lagging, not the bot. Support may restart the bot; do not touch the events table. The bot reads deploy state from the database below.

warehouse DSN: clickhouse://druys_svc:Pl@db-47e1.orvexstack.corp:5432/beldor